In this interview, we chat with Rune Christensen from MakerDAO (https://twitter.com/MakerDAO) about stablecoins, MakerDAO’s take on this concept, the peg and how this is maintained, security, oracles and more.
Here are a few of the terms that we discuss in the episode:
* DAI: a crypto asset-backed token pegged to the USD  — it is designed to maintain a stable value.
* MKR: Valuebearing, tradeable token. As a governance token, MKR holders have the responsibility of making risk based decisions that will influence the future health of the system.
* CDP: The MakerDAO Collateralized Debt Position (CDP) is a smart contract which runs on the Ethereum blockchain. It is a core component of the Dai Stablecoin System whose purpose is to create Dai in exchange for collateral which it then holds in escrow until the borrowed Dai is returned.
